Graph Blockchain in Discussions With Ministry of Trade and Agriculture


TORONTO, Nov. 15,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Graph Blockchain Inc. (“Graph” or “Company”) (CSE: GBLC) is very pleased to announce that in collaboration with Datametrex AI Limited (“Datametrex”, TSXV: DM), discussions have been held with senior officers of a multi-national conglomerate in conjunction with Counsellors from the Canadian Ministry of Trade and the Ministry of Agriculture, to provide Blockchain logistics and Global Supply Chain Management solutions in relation to Canadian beef importation.

In partnership with Datametrex, Graph was invited to the Canadian Embassy in Seoul, Korea, to discuss building supply chain management and logistics solutions, leveraging Datametrex’s expertise in AI, in combination with Graph’s high development proficiency of blockchain data management and analytics platforms in the logistics and global trade sector.

As reported in the Beef Quarterly Research Report published by Rabobank in August 2018 (click here), North Asia, and more specifically Japan and South Korea, have been increasing their beef imports over the past year, with the highest rise in imports since 2002.  With global concerns arising over Bovine Spongiform Encephalopathy (BSE), commonly known as mad cow disease, a major point and condition of the parties involved in the meeting was the quality assurance of imported beef.  In addition, the blockchain based solutions will include development of reporting and auditing systems for tracking and tracing, quality control, delivery, payments, and quotas.

About Graph Blockchain Inc.

The Company develops leading-edge private blockchain business intelligence and data management solutions and is a pure play in the graph database technology space. Graph leverages their proprietary integration of the AgensGraph Database engine with IBM’s Hyperledger Fabric to create a transparent and immutable ledger with near real-time transactional data processing and intuitive data visualization. The Company’s powerfully unique solution has translated into a high growth trajectory, with the company securing multiple prototype development contracts with multi-national conglomerates, and the opportunity to sell across client subsidiaries as a full enterprise product.
